Introduction

Traditional web development requires stitching together frontend frameworks, backend servers, databases, and hosting infrastructure. This technical barrier has historically prevented non-developers from turning concepts into working software quickly.

The market has shifted toward natural language app generation, enabling founders and operators to bypass setup and boilerplate code simply by describing their desired outcome. This emerging methodology, often referred to as vibe coding, allows users to build real, functional products using only text prompts, completely removing the friction of manual programming and complex deployments.

Buyer Considerations

When evaluating plain-English app builders, buyers must determine whether the tool generates a true full-stack application. Many AI builders focus solely on creating static frontend user interfaces, leaving the builder responsible for structuring databases and writing backend logic. A functional web app requires a unified system where data, authentication, and logic are generated together based on the prompt.

Buyers should also consider the deployment process and data ownership. It is important to check if the platform forces complex external hosting configurations or offers immediate live URLs. Furthermore, organizations should verify whether they can export source code to hand off to developers if they eventually outgrow the platform's ecosystem.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I really build a database just by describing it in plain English?

Yes, advanced application generators analyze your text prompt to automatically structure the necessary database tables, relationships, and data storage solutions required for your app to function.

How detailed does my text description need to be?

While simple prompts can generate a basic application, providing clear details about your desired features, user roles, and data requirements will yield a much more accurate and functional web app.

Do these tools generate the backend logic as well as the design?

Leading full-stack generators do both. They interpret your prompt to build the visual frontend while simultaneously wiring up the backend APIs, authentication, and data management.

How do I get my generated app on the internet?

The best platforms provide instant deployment capabilities, automatically hosting your web application and allowing you to attach a custom domain immediately after the generation process is complete.
